DRM 保護和內容授權發佈
[與此頁面相關聯的功能 Windows Media Format 11 SDK是舊版功能。 來源讀取器和接收寫入器已取代它。 來源讀取器和接收寫入器已針對Windows 10和Windows 11進行優化。 Microsoft 強烈建議新程式碼盡可能使用來源讀取器和接收寫入器,而不是Windows 媒體格式 11 SDK。 Microsoft 建議使用舊版 API 的現有程式碼盡可能重寫為使用新的 API。
在建立端,數位版權管理技術牽涉到兩個主要程式: (1) 保護內容, (2) 提供內容的授權。 保護檔案基本上牽涉到加密內容,並在檔頭中包含 URL,指定可以取得內容的授權位置。 如果您想要使用 保護檔案,然後將檔案散發至其他電腦或裝置,您可以使用 Windows 媒體格式 SDK 或 Windows 媒體版權管理員 SDK 來保護檔案。 針對即時 DRM 案例,您必須使用 Windows 媒體格式 SDK 來保護正在編碼的內容。
若要建立及發行受保護內容的授權,您可以使用 Windows 媒體版權管理員 SDK 的物件來建立自己的自訂解決方案,或使用協力廠商所執行的服務。
無論您使用哪種方法,您建立的受保護檔案都會包含在 DRM 標頭物件中,該 URL 會告知用戶端應用程式要在哪裡取得內容的授權。
注意
Windows 媒體格式 SDK 不支援建立或發行授權。
在播放端,已啟用 DRM 的應用程式必須能夠取得受保護內容的授權、使用授權中包含的金鑰解密該內容,以及強制執行授許可權制,例如檔案可能播放的次數,或檔案是否可以複製到另一部裝置。 Windows 媒體格式 SDK 提供建立完整 DRM 播放應用程式所需的所有支援。
注意
此 SDK 的 x64 型版本不支援 DRM。
相關主題